Abstract

The utility model discloses a kind of Tire Explosion-proof heat sink, it is intended to solves that tyre temperature in vehicle traveling process is higher, and tire is easy to aging, or even the risk blown out occurs, the deficiency of very big security risk is brought to driving.The utility model includes the pedestal being installed on wheel cover medial surface, and the blowing impeller that can be dried towards tire is provided with pedestal.Tire is blowed by blowing impeller in vehicle traveling process, so as to cool down to tire, prevent that tyre temperature is excessive, delayed the aging of tire, avoid because of the phenomenon of blowing out that tyre temperature is excessive and occurs, eliminate the excessive security risk brought of tyre temperature.

Description

Tire Explosion-proof heat sink
Technical field
A kind of automobile auxiliary system is the utility model is related to, more specifically, it relates to which a kind of Tire Explosion-proof cools down Device.
Background technology
When driving, tire directly contacts vehicle with ground, ceaselessly deforms and rubs, produces substantial amounts of energy loss, make Raised into tyre temperature, high temperature can not only accelerate the aging of tire, reduce the performance of tire, and cause since heat is too high Blow out, therefore reduce Life of Tyre, increase the probability blown out, be a big hidden danger of traffic safety.Automobile tire at present Ambient windstream in driving conditions is generally leaned on to cool down, this cooling method effect is undesirable, particularly in the hot summer In season, environment temperature is inherently higher, and tire can produce the heat of bigger after friction is contacted with ground, pass through ambient windstream at this time Cool down, effect is more undesirable.
Utility model content
The utility model overcomes that tyre temperature in vehicle traveling process is higher, and tire is easy to aging, or even occurs what is blown out Risk, the deficiency of very big security risk is brought to driving, there is provided a kind of Tire Explosion-proof heat sink, it is to tire Good cooling effect, surface of tyre is less prone to high temperature in driving conditions, has delayed the aging of tire, has avoided because of tyre temperature mistake High and appearance phenomenon of blowing out, eliminates the excessive security risk brought of tyre temperature.
In order to solve the above-mentioned technical problem, the utility model uses following technical scheme:A kind of Tire Explosion-proof cooling Device, including the pedestal on wheel cover medial surface, the blowing impeller that can be dried towards tire is provided with pedestal.
Tire is blowed by blowing impeller in vehicle traveling process, so as to cool down to tire, prevents tire Temperature is excessive, has delayed the aging of tire, avoids because of the phenomenon of blowing out that tyre temperature is excessive and occurs, eliminates tyre temperature The excessive security risk brought.
Preferably, being provided with protective cover on the outside of pedestal up-draught impeller, some playpipes are laid with protective cover, Several waterfog heads are installed, waterfog head is set towards tire, installs flow pipe on protective cover, playpipe is equal on playpipe Connected with flow pipe, flow pipe connection water pump, water pump connection water storage barrel, water pump and water storage barrel are installed on automobile, on pedestal Temperature detector is installed, temperature detector, water pump are electrically connected with automobile ECU.
The temperature signal for the tire location that automobile ECU is detected according to temperature detector, control water pump open and close.When When the temperature detected is higher than setting value, automobile ECU control water pump is opened, and the cooling water in water storage barrel passes through flow pipe, injection Pipe, ejects from waterfog head towards tire, cools down to tire, while blowing impeller breaks up water mist to tire blowing, Make cooling of the water mist to tire more uniform.Current cool down in vaporific be ejected on tire, avoid remaining on tire Current are excessive and tyre slip phenomenon occur.
Preferably, being provided with driving motor on pedestal, driving motor output shaft is connected with blowing impeller, driving motor electricity Connect automobile ECU, automobile ECU collection tire tach signal, automobile ECU by the temperature signal of temperature detector that collects and Tire rotational speed signal controls driving motor.
Blowing impeller is driven by driving motor and rotated, when the temperature that automobile ECU detects is higher than setting value, control driving electricity Machine rotates, and the rotating speed of driving motor is controlled according to the tire rotational speed of automobile, and tire rotational speed is faster, and driving motor speed is got over It hurry up.Control is precisely convenient.
Preferably, baffle is installed above wheel cover medial surface top base.Baffle is used to block the mud that band on tire comes Water, prevents muddy water beating from causing mechanical breakdown to blowing impeller.
Compared with prior art, the beneficial effects of the utility model are:Tire Explosion-proof heat sink cools down tire Effect is good, and surface of tyre is less prone to high temperature in driving conditions, has delayed the aging of tire, avoid because tyre temperature is excessive and The phenomenon of blowing out occurred, eliminates the excessive security risk brought of tyre temperature.

Embodiment
Below by specific embodiment, and with reference to attached drawing, the technical solution of the utility model is made further specifically to retouch State:
Embodiment:A kind of Tire Explosion-proof heat sink(Referring to attached drawing 1, attached drawing 2), including installed in the inner side of wheel cover 8 Pedestal 1 on face, the blowing impeller 2 that can be dried towards tire is provided with pedestal.It is provided with the outside of pedestal up-draught impeller anti- Shield 3, is laid with six roots of sensation playpipe 4 on protective cover, is provided with two waterfog heads 5 on playpipe, and waterfog head is towards wheel Tire is set, and flow pipe 6 is installed on protective cover, and playpipe is connected with flow pipe, flow pipe connection water pump, water pump connection water storage Bucket, water pump and water storage barrel are installed on automobile, and temperature detector, temperature detector, water pump and automobile ECU are provided with pedestal It is electrically connected.Driving motor is installed on pedestal, driving motor is powered by automobile, and driving motor output shaft is connected with blowing impeller, Motor is driven to be electrically connected automobile ECU, automobile ECU collection tire tach signal, automobile ECU passes through the temperature detector that collects Temperature signal and tire rotational speed signal control driving motor.Baffle 7 is installed above wheel cover medial surface top base.
The temperature signal for the tire location that automobile ECU is detected according to temperature detector, control water pump open and close.When When the temperature detected is higher than setting value, automobile ECU control water pump is opened, and the cooling water in water storage barrel passes through flow pipe, injection Pipe, ejects from waterfog head towards tire, cools down to tire, while blowing impeller breaks up water mist to tire blowing, Make cooling of the water mist to tire more uniform.Current cool down in vaporific be ejected on tire, avoid remaining on tire Current are excessive and tyre slip phenomenon occur.Blowing impeller is driven by driving motor and rotated, and the temperature that automobile ECU detects is higher than During setting value, control driving motor rotates, and the rotating speed of driving motor is controlled according to the tire rotational speed of automobile, and tire rotational speed is got over It hurry up, driving motor speed is faster.Control is precisely convenient.
